Storm window replacement services involve removing aging or damaged storm windows and installing new units to improve a building’s exterior protection. These services typically include inspecting the existing storm windows, selecting appropriate replacement options, and securely installing the new units to ensure a proper fit. Proper installation can help prevent drafts, reduce energy loss, and enhance the overall durability of the window system. Professionals in this field often work with a variety of storm window styles and materials to match the architectural features of different properties.

One of the primary problems storm window replacement addresses is air leakage. Older or damaged storm windows can develop gaps, cracks, or warping, which allow drafts to enter and conditioned air to escape. This can lead to increased heating and cooling costs and reduced indoor comfort. Additionally, storm windows serve as a barrier against outdoor elements such as wind, rain, and debris, helping to protect the primary window and the interior of the property. Replacing worn storm windows can restore their effectiveness and contribute to maintaining a consistent indoor environment.

Cost Range for Storm Window Replacement - The typical cost for replacing storm windows varies based on size and material, generally falling between $300 and $800 per window. Larger or custom-sized units can increase the expense, reaching up to $1,200 each.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on the property’s needs.

Factors Affecting Cost - Costs are influenced by window size, type of storm window, and installation complexity. For example, standard double-pane storm windows tend to be more affordable, while custom or specialty options may cost more. Budget considerations should include both materials and labor fees.

Average Cost per Project - A typical storm window replacement project for a single-family home in Dekalb County might range from $1,000 to $3,000 in total. This includes multiple windows and installation services from local contractors. Contacting local providers can help determine precise pricing for specific properties.

Cost Variations and Estimates - Prices can vary significantly depending on the number of windows and their sizes, with some projects costing as low as $500 or as high as $5,000. Local service providers can offer tailored quotes to match the scope of each storm window replacement project.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m window replacement services? Storm window replacement services involve removing old or damaged storm windows and installing new ones to improve insulation, weather resistance, and energy efficiency.

How do I know if my storm windows need replacing? Signs such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, visible damage, or condensation between panes may indicate the need for storm window replacement.

What types of storm windows are available for replacement? Replacement options include aluminum, vinyl, wood, and hybrid storm windows,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.

How can I find local professionals for storm window replacement? Contact local contractors or service providers specializing in window installation and replacement to get assistance with storm window upgrades.

Are storm window replacements covered by warranties? Warranty coverage varies by manufacturer and contractor; it’s advisable to inquire about warranty options when consulting with local providers.
